actionscript 相当于 php 爆炸

Posted

技术标签:

【中文标题】actionscript 相当于 php 爆炸【英文标题】:actionscript equivilent to php explode 【发布时间】:2013-07-01 11:30:12 【问题描述】:

例如我有这个网址

/softwarename/object/display?ObjRef=//Sitename/100.AI1

我想在 actionscript 中编写一个脚本,该脚本根据用户的“站点名称”和结尾的 ID 动态地将用户带到 URl,如示例“100.AI1”所示。

希望我能得到一些帮助。

谢谢

【问题讨论】:

【参考方案1】:

相当于 php explode() 的 Actionscript 将是 String.split()

函数签名几乎相同,只是因为 AS3 面向对象而有所不同。

var url:String = "/softwarename/object/display?ObjRef=//Sitename/100.AI1";
var results:Array = url.split("ObjRef=//");
var variables:Array = results[1].split("/");
var sitename:String = variables[0];
var id:String = variables[1];

或者只是使用regular expression:

var url:String = "/softwarename/object/display?ObjRef=//Sitename/100.AI1";
var regex:RegExp = /.*ObjRef=\/\/(.*)\/(.*)/;
var regexResult:Object = regex.exec(url);
var sitename:String = regexResult[1];
var id:String = regesResult[2];

【讨论】:

以上是关于actionscript 相当于 php 爆炸的主要内容,如果未能解决你的问题,请参考以下文章

20190614考试心态爆炸记

ZZNU-OJ-2118 -(台球桌面碰来碰去,求总距离)——模拟到爆炸的不能AC的代码

用PHP语言刷OJ题

PHP 无法从 ActionScript3 接收参数

Flash lite 1.1 Actionscript 和 PHP

通过 php 将 ActionScript 值写入文件